Hope, healing, and happily-ever-afters: lesbian medical romances with heart.

Book 1: "Melody in Her Heart"

She swore she wouldn’t cross the line—until Jenni made her want to burn it.

Nurse Tabitha Brickly should have it all: a career, kids, and a husband. Instead, she’s exhausted, lonely, and aching for something more. Enter Jennifer Jennison—older, gorgeous, and completely off-limits. Their chemistry is instant, their attraction undeniable. Jenni knows Tabby is married and complicated, but resisting her feels impossible. As secrets mount, both women must decide: risk everything for a love that feels like destiny, or let fear keep them apart.

Book 2: "Fighting Her Touch"

She’s engaged to a man. She can’t stop thinking about a woman.

Elizabeth Fletcher’s future is set: marry her rich fiancé and give up nursing. But one look at Marisa Cavanaugh, a confident older woman on her ward, and Liz’s perfect plan unravels. Marisa knows Liz is too young, too conflicted—and far too engaged. Yet every touch, every glance draws them closer. Their passion is electric, their secret dangerous, and Liz is hiding something that could destroy it all. Will they risk everything for inevitable love, or let fear tear them apart?

Book 3: "Protecting Her Heart"

Protecting her heart just became the hardest fight of all.

Bella Strong has it all lined up—nursing school, a steady boyfriend, a future. The last thing she needs is distraction. Then Dr. Leona Guillano walks in: brilliant, older, and dangerously irresistible. Both are guarding secrets, yet the pull between them is undeniable. Every glance tests Bella’s resolve, every touch threatens to unravel everything. Can she risk her future for a love worth protecting—or will fear lock her heart away forever?

Let your happily-ever-afters begin now. Enjoy an emotional journey of hope, heart, and healing.

Book 2:
Fighting Her Touch


Age gap (19 years).
Workplace romance.
Set in a hospital.
Fun group of work friends.
Second chances.
Nurses.


Theoretically cute but the writing was … odd at times. And had some issues other times, such as regarding plausibility and continuity. And honestly, continuity issues and cheesy writing ruins it for me. Between that and the commercial smack in the middle of the content, 2 stars.

Continuity (& other) issues -
🙄 Liz is shown as going to talk to her superiors about taking time off. She gets the time off. Then she gets fired for not being at work.
🙄 Liz’s age changes several times, as does Marissa’s.
🙄 They’re described as removing their sh!rts and “pressed their br34sts together”. Is that supposed to be hot or … believable?! Yikes.
🙄 Heard, “...kissed the inside of my cl34v4ge…” Come on.


There was an advertisement right in the middle of it, (Right before Chapter 11.)
Not cool, pulled me right out of the story. Usually authors save these for their backmatter. I don’t want ‘commercials’ in my audiobooks, thanks.

Book 3:
Protecting Her Heart

Honestly, this went exactly the same way books 1 and 2 did. Young, brand new employee in this hospital has a boyfriend she doesn’t really like. Attractive coworker twice her age instantly falls for her upon sight. They live happily ever after.


Overall,
All 3 books had the potential to be cute, but with bad writing, no continuity, and the same book written 3 times just with some different names, it didn’t really work for me.

🎧 Audio:
Overall sound quality was okay, mostly smooth though there were some instances of repeated sentences and words.
The narrator doesn’t sound like a robot, which is nice but in each installment, there was at least one character who sounded like a chipmunk—this could make it hard to take them seriously, and after a while got to be a bit hard to take.
